    Well, it isn't that hard actually, get your mana up to the max, pick up every piece of armor (yes even clothes) for the of power or of life enchantments, being l+ helps a lot, and get all the bookcasting talents. As a wizard you can drain wands twice with mana battery, and if you need more hp then set up a gremlin bomb near jharod, cast light and heal away. (Doesn't count as you who damaged them when you cast light)
    So, if l+, cast on silvernight. With 2 spellbooks you can use up 1 book then get 1 reading from the 2nd, each casting from memory uses ~250 memory so bookcast for "power" use mana orb to regen pp, bookcast for scrolls of chaos resist, repeat. If your stat drains get you below the ability to bookcast, you can cast it as normal with your extra spell knowledge.

    Forgot to tell you; casting from hp uses a *lot* of satiation!! You can starve to death in 1 casting if you aren't super bloated all the time.

    I'm about to complete my first (and last - all that wishing is TEDIOUS) archmage, and yeah the mana orb makes it really easy.

    The ToTRR also helps a lot on getting your starting Mana up to 99 (the Mana orb will over time peg your mana to 99 since you gain 3 Mana per use and lose only about 1 per wish (you lose 10 from a random stat, but it's often not Mana).

    As Blank said, wish for power to quickly get yourself out of HP cast range.
    Also, be prepared to not wander the wilderness while your stats are all at 1 - bring everything you need(stomafillia, etc) with you when you start your silvernight book casting.


    Edit:
    As far as surviving the early game, I think you should sell that book of Wish for a lot of money and use it to buy stuff. You can always buy it back later. (And there's the free one in the Library)

    Wish draining attribute at 1 point will not kill you but has a chance to lower stat potential.

    If you use Mana Orb Mana will generally keep itself in the high values as you get -10 Mana per 9 wishes on average (when your pool is only enough for 1 wish) and restore 27 by using Mana Orb. When you get enough PP to bookcast twice and thrice, Mana will generally diminish much faster but at this point it's irrelevant.

    Anyway, as Blank said:
    1) get enough HP/PP, stack on blessed stoma, blessed satiation scrolls and holy water
    2) eat blessed stoma, wait till satiated and eat another one -or- read a couple of scrolls (this is the most important part, be careful around satiation)
    3) bookcast wish
    4) replenish HP, use Mana orb with elemental gauntlets
    5) repeat until necessary

    Your first wishes should be for "power" and "scrolls of corruption removal". Alternate wishes according to your alignment (neutral - more scroll wishes, lawful - more power wishes).

    Look out for rooms that say "The atmosphere of this room makes your skin tingle!"
    They offer 20% reduction on casting costs.
    This feature stacks with mana battery reduction for a total of 40%, which is not much less than silverlight and has the added benefit that you can use it any time instead of waiting for silvernight.
    As for the spellbook at such an early stage of the game, it's what Jelly said - sell it, preferably in HMV since prices there are much better than in bandit town.
    It will be a long time before you need it so you might as well use the gold instead.
